Race & Ethnicity

University of Montana has a diverse student body with 28% students of color and 1% international students, creating a rich multicultural learning environment that celebrates students from all racial and ethnic backgrounds.

Racial & Ethnic Composition

White
72.1%(6,508)
Hispanic
6.3%(572)
African American
0.9%(81)
Asian
1.2%(112)
American Indian or Alaska Native
3.5%(318)
Pacific Islander
0.1%(8)
Two or More Races
11.3%(1,025)
Unknown
4.5%(408)

Gender Distribution

University of Montana has a gender distribution of 58% female students and 42% male students.

Overall Gender Distribution

Men
42.4%(3,887)
Women
57.5%(5,273)
Other
0.0%(3.5)

Age Distribution

University of Montana serves a diverse student population across multiple age demographics. The university enrolls 49% traditional college-age students (18-21 years old) and 16% non-traditional students aged 25 and older.

Undergraduate Ages

Under 18
5.5%(416)
18-19
32.1%(2,427)
20-21
27.3%(2,068)
22-24
15.5%(1,172)
25+
19.6%(1,487)

Graduate Student Ages

20-21
1.2%(33)
22-24
17.1%(472)
25+
81.7%(2,252)

Geographic Diversity

University of Montana attracts students from across the United States and internationally, with 1% international students contributing to a globally diverse campus community. The student body includes 57% in-state residents, 42% out-of-state students, and 1% international students, creating rich cross-cultural learning opportunities.

Geographic Origin

In-State
57.0%(890)
Out-of-State
42.3%(660)
International
0.7%(11)
